Why Subaru Forester Car Cover Is Necessary
I learned that using a Subaru Forester car cover is one of the simplest ways to protect my vehicle from daily damage. My Forester sits outside often, and a good cover helps shield it from dust, bird droppings, tree sap, rain, UV rays, and even light scratches. It gives me peace of mind knowing the paint and exterior stay in better condition for longer.
I also find that a car cover helps keep my Subaru cleaner, which saves me time and effort. Instead of washing it as often, I can remove the cover and find less dirt on the surface. It is especially useful during harsh weather, whether it is strong sun in summer or snow and frost in winter.
For me, the cover is also a smart way to preserve the value of my Forester. A well-protected exterior can help the car look newer and reduce wear over time. That makes the car cover not just a simple accessory, but a practical investment in keeping my Subaru Forester protected and ready for the road.

Choosing the Right Material
I found that material matters a lot depending on where I park my car:
- Outdoor use: I preferred a waterproof or water-resistant cover with UV protection.
- Indoor use: A softer, breathable cover worked better for dust and light scratches.
- All-weather use: I looked for multi-layer covers that could handle sun, rain, and snow.
I made sure the inside lining was gentle enough so it would not rub against the paint.
Fit and Size Matter Most
I learned quickly that a loose cover can flap in the wind and cause damage, while a tight one is hard to put on and remove. For my Subaru Forester, I looked for:
- Custom-fit or semi-custom sizing
- Elastic hems for a snug hold
- Mirror pockets if needed
- Straps or buckles for windy conditions
A proper fit gave me peace of mind, especially during storms.
Weather Protection I Considered
Since I wanted year-round protection, I checked how well the cover handled different weather conditions:
- Sun protection: To prevent fading and cracking
- Rain protection: To keep the body dry and reduce water spots
- Snow and frost protection: For winter months
- Dust protection: For long parking periods
I also looked for breathable fabric so moisture would not get trapped underneath.

Indoor vs Outdoor Cover: What I Chose
I had to decide whether I needed an indoor or outdoor cover. For my use, an outdoor all-weather cover made more sense because my Forester spends a lot of time outside. If your Subaru stays in a garage most of the time, I think a lighter indoor cover may be enough. But for outdoor parking, I would always choose stronger protection.
My Final Buying Tips
If I were buying again, I would remember these points:
- Choose the correct size for the Subaru Forester
- Pick a material based on your weather conditions
- Make sure the cover is breathable
- Look for secure straps or elastic hems
- Check if the inside is soft enough to protect the paint
- Choose a cover that is easy for me to use daily
